```AI Architect: Designs and implements AI-driven solutions, leveraging architectural data mining to optimize building performance. Average salaries in tech for this role range from £70,000 to £100,000.
Data Scientist: Analyzes complex datasets to uncover insights, with a focus on AI skills in demand. Salaries typically range from £50,000 to £80,000.
Machine Learning Engineer: Develops algorithms and models, integrating AI into architectural data systems. Average salaries in tech for this role are £60,000 to £90,000.
Big Data Analyst: Processes large datasets to identify trends, with a growing demand for AI expertise. Salaries range from £45,000 to £70,000.
Cloud Solutions Architect: Designs cloud-based systems, often incorporating AI and data mining techniques. Average salaries in tech for this role are £65,000 to £95,000.
